Our second pillar is our support community. 

We provide specialist individual, couple, family and group support tailored to people affected by rarer or young onset dementia. 

Membership is free to people affected by dementia and practitioners. Membership includes the ability to connect with our support team, advice and information, and education. 

We encourage anyone with interest in rarer dementias to register for membership with us.

Our community includes people living with or at risk of a rare or young onset dementia diagnosis, family, friends, and practitioners (nurses, doctors, speech therapists, occupational therapists, social workers, personal support workers and more).

Once registered, people who are directly affected by rare or young onset dementia will have the option to request direct support. Practitioners will receive information on upcoming educational opportunities and options to connect to research and learning.
